Unlocking The Potential Of Custom Assays In Biomedical Research

In the field of biomedical research, custom assays play a crucial role in helping scientists understand complex biological systems. These specialized tests are designed to measure the activity or concentration of specific molecules, such as proteins, nucleic acids, or small molecules. By tailoring assays to meet the unique needs of a particular experiment, researchers can obtain precise and reliable data that is essential for making groundbreaking discoveries.

custom assays are especially valuable in situations where standard assay kits do not provide the necessary sensitivity or specificity. For example, researchers may need to detect low levels of a particular biomarker in a complex biological sample, or they may be interested in studying the activity of a specific enzymatic pathway. In such cases, a custom assay can be developed to target the molecule of interest with precision, ensuring that the results are accurate and meaningful.

One of the key advantages of custom assays is their flexibility. Researchers have the freedom to design assays that are tailored to their specific experimental requirements, allowing them to address unique research questions that cannot be answered using off-the-shelf kits. This level of customization is especially valuable in the era of personalized medicine, where individualized treatment strategies rely on the ability to accurately measure biomarkers in patient samples.

custom assays can be developed using a variety of techniques, including enzyme-linked immunosorbent assays (ELISAs), polymerase chain reaction (PCR), and high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C). Each method has its own strengths and limitations, and researchers must carefully consider which approach is best suited to their experimental needs. By working closely with assay development experts, scientists can ensure that their custom assay meets the highest standards of quality and performance.

In addition to their flexibility, custom assays offer another important advantage: cost-effectiveness. While developing a custom assay may require an initial investment of time and resources, the long-term benefits of having a reliable and precise measurement tool can far outweigh the upfront costs. By avoiding the need to purchase multiple standard assay kits for different experiments, researchers can streamline their workflows and achieve more consistent results.

Furthermore, custom assays can be easily optimized and validated to ensure their reliability and reproducibility. By conducting rigorous testing and validation studies, researchers can demonstrate that their custom assay performs consistently across different sample types and experimental conditions. This validation process is essential for ensuring the accuracy and validity of the data generated by the assay, ultimately leading to more robust and reliable research findings.
